Abstract

Disclosed are a method and apparatus for generating local metadata including position information of a similar color mapping region and a color mapping function of the similar color mapping region and a method and apparatus for correcting color components 5 of a pixel in a similar color mapping region based on local metadata.

Claims (71)

1. A metadata generation method comprising:

acquiring at least one of a tone mapping function and a saturation correction function between a first image and a second image based on pixels included in the first image and pixels included in the second image;

correcting the first image by performing the at least one of the tone mapping function and the saturation correction function on the first image;

generating global metadata including the at least one of the tone mapping function and the saturation correction function;

splitting the corrected first image into a plurality of regions based on spatial proximity and color similarity of pixels included in the corrected first image;

acquiring a color mapping function of a first region among the plurality of regions by comparing color information of pixels in the first region with color information of pixels in the second image, which correspond to the pixels in the first region;

acquiring a color mapping function of a second region among the plurality of regions by comparing color information of pixels in the second region with color information of pixels in the second image, which correspond to the pixels in the second region;

setting the first region and the second region as a similar color mapping region by comparing the color mapping function of the first region with the color mapping function of the second region;

acquiring a color mapping function of the similar color mapping region based on the color mapping function of the first region and the color mapping function of the second region; and

generating local metadata including position information of the similar color mapping region in the corrected first image and the color mapping function of the similar color mapping region.
